------- Additional Comments From pb at gcc dot gnu dot org 2004-05-09 17:11 -------
For that particular testcase, adding a pattern like the one below seems to allow
combine to do the right thing. However, changing the "return 1" to "return 2"
prevents this from matching. Something a bit more sophisticated might be needed.
--
(define_insn_and_split "*zero_extract_compare0_shifted"
[(set (match_operand:SI 0 "s_register_operand" "=r")
(ne:SI (zero_extract:SI (match_operand:SI 1 "s_register_operand" "r")
(match_operand:SI 2 "const_int_operand" "n")
(const_int 0))
(const_int 0)))
(clobber (reg:CC CC_REGNUM))]
"TARGET_ARM"
"#"
""
[(parallel [(set (reg:CC_NOOV CC_REGNUM)
(compare:CC_NOOV (ashift:SI (match_dup 1)
(match_dup 2))
(const_int 0)))
(set (match_dup 0)
(ashift:SI (match_dup 1) (match_dup 2)))])
(set (match_dup 0)
(if_then_else (eq:SI (reg:CC_NOOV CC_REGNUM) (const_int 0))
(match_dup 0)
(const_int 1)))]
""
)
;; Match the second half of *zero_extract_compare0_shifted
(define_insn "*movsi_conditional"
[(set (match_operand:SI 0 "s_register_operand" "=r")
(if_then_else (eq:SI (reg:CC_NOOV CC_REGNUM) (const_int 0))
(match_dup 0)
(match_operand:SI 1 "const_int_operand" "n")))]
"TARGET_ARM"
"movne\\t%0, %1"
[(set_attr "conds" "use")]
)
